O'Malley vs. Zahabi Set for June 14 on White House Lawn

A win could move the victor toward a bantamweight title shot, with O'Malley saying only a decisive knockout will strengthen his case.

Overview

  • The bantamweight fight between former champion Sean O'Malley and contender Aiemann Zahabi is confirmed for June 14 at UFC Freedom 250 on the White House South Lawn.
  • The bout is presented as a potential No. 1 contender test that could put the winner in line for a title shot at 135 pounds.
  • O'Malley is the clear betting favorite and has publicly said he must finish Zahabi with a knockout to help secure another title opportunity.
  • Zahabi arrives on a seven-fight winning streak, is ranked No. 6, employs an unconventional striking style many call tricky, and is backed by his Tristar camp after UFC matchmakers contacted his coach.
  • The White House card raises the fight's visibility as part of UFC Freedom 250, though UFC officials have not formally labeled the bout an official eliminator.
